Common Types of RF Connectors

SMA Connectors – The Reliable Standard

SMA connectors are widely used for antennas, testing equipment, and telecom systems. They offer reliable performance up to 18 GHz and are a common choice for laboratory and industrial environments.

High-Frequency Connectors

Connectors such as 3.5mm, 2.92mm, 2.4mm, and 1.85mm are designed for very high-frequency applications. They are used in 5G networks, radar, and aerospace systems, where precision and stability are crucial.

N-Type Connectors – Outdoor Durability

N-Type connectors are rugged and weather-resistant, making them suitable for outdoor applications such as telecom towers, base stations, and wireless networks.

BNC / TNC / HD-BNC Connectors – Quick or High-Density

BNC and TNC connectors are easy to use and provide quick connections for broadcast and test equipment. HD-BNC connectors, in particular, are compact high-density solutions ideal for 12G-SDI video, 5G, and professional broadcast systems.

QMA Connectors – Fast and Convenient

QMA connectors offer quick-lock functionality, saving time in assembly while maintaining reliable RF performance.

IPEX / Murata – Ultra-Miniature Connectors

These miniature connectors are designed for smartphones, IoT devices, and compact communication modules, where space-saving is critical.

FAKRA RF Connectors – Automotive Communication

FAKRA connectors are standardized, color-coded RF connectors widely used in the automotive industry. They support GPS, ADAS, infotainment, and 5G vehicle communication systems, providing secure connections even under vibration and harsh conditions.

Buyer Challenges

Selecting the right RF connector can be challenging. Buyers often face issues such as:

  • Matching connectors to frequency and power requirements

  • Ensuring durability for outdoor or harsh environments

  • Choosing the right size for compact electronic devices

  • Balancing performance with cost-effectiveness
